**Handover — SDK parity (Tarnbox client libs)**

State of play: the Vane SDK (Go) is ahead of the Pell SDK (Python). Missing in Pell: streaming uploads, retry jitter, scoped tokens. Support impact: Python users hitting timeouts on large payloads — known, tracked, no workaround beyond chunking manually. Don't promise parity dates. Parity matrix lives in the repo wiki. Both SDKs read the same service config, currently set as follows.

service settings:
BRIATH_LOG_LEVEL=warn
BRIATH_METRICS_HOST=metrics.briath.zemvarsys.internal
BRIATH_POOL_SIZE=16

## Holiday-Period Opening Hours — Corven House

From 24 December to 2 January, Corven House operates night-shift-only staffing. Main doors lock at 18:00 sharp; use the rear entrance on the loading court. Sign the paper log even if the scanner accepts your badge — the audit team checks both. The rear door requires the holiday override code shown below.

staff pass of haduf-yagaf = bdg-DBSQF-1

Subject: SFTP cut-over — done (mostly)

Hey — welcome aboard. Quick recap since you'll own this next week: we moved the Bramleigh partner feed off the old drop box and onto the new Ferrypost SFTP endpoint on Tuesday. Files now land hourly instead of nightly, and the poller archives anything older than seven days. One partner still pushes with the legacy naming scheme; the poller handles both for now. Everything the poller needs to connect and sweep the drop is set in the block below.

service settings:
PRAWYN_PIN=9848
PRAWYN_METRICS_HOST=metrics.prawyn.lumicworks.corp
PRAWYN_LOG_LEVEL=warn
PRAWYN_TENANT=pelius